how to calculate the size of cable for 100 kva load,?can
somebody tell me with a formula
Answer Posted / brijesh shakya
Before calculating size of cable, phase & voltage should be
clear then after we can calculate the current of load by
this formula
P=root3*V*I
I=P/(root3*V)
Accodingle we can select the size of cale.
